About Spring Health

Spring Health offers personalized mental health solutions to employers and health plans, focusing on enhancing employee well-being. Their Precision Mental Healthcare system tailors support to individuals, providing options like digital resources, therapy, and medication. Users receive a customized care plan after a brief assessment, allowing them to schedule appointments and access wellness exercises easily. The goal is to improve workplace mental health by providing effective and accessible resources.

Risks

Increased competition from digital mental health platforms offering similar services at lower costs.
Rapid technological advancements may outpace Spring Health's current AI capabilities.
Potential data privacy concerns could impact user trust and compliance costs.

Differentiation

Spring Health uses Precision Mental Healthcare for personalized mental health solutions.
The company offers a comprehensive platform with digital support, therapy, and medication.
Spring Health is the first to earn nationwide third-party accreditation for clinical care.

Upsides

Spring Health raised $100M in Series E funding, valuing it at $3.3 billion.
The company collaborates with major brands like Microsoft and Target.
Spring Health's Community Care solution addresses mental health equity and social determinants.
